Abstract

Effective lesson planning is a crucial element in successful teaching, especially when it comes to teaching a foreign language. Lesson planning is the process of outlining the goals, instructional strategies, and assessment methods for each lesson. It is a road map that guides teachers in delivering effective and engaging lessons that meet the needs of their students. In the context of teaching a foreign language, lesson planning plays a critical role in providing structure, ensuring clarity, maximizing learning opportunities, and promoting student engagement.
